Medical Imaging Interaction Toolkit
2018.4.99-389bf124
Medical Imaging Interaction Toolkit
berryISelectionChangedListener.cpp
Go to the documentation of this file.
1
/*============================================================================
2
3
The Medical Imaging Interaction Toolkit (MITK)
4
5
Copyright (c) German Cancer Research Center (DKFZ)
6
All rights reserved.
7
8
Use of this source code is governed by a 3-clause BSD license that can be
9
found in the LICENSE file.
10
11
============================================================================*/
12
13
#include "
berryISelectionChangedListener.h
"
14
#include "
berryISelectionProvider.h
"
15
16
namespace
berry
{
17
18
void
19
ISelectionChangedListener::Events
20
::AddListener
(
ISelectionChangedListener
* listener)
21
{
22
if
(listener ==
nullptr
)
return
;
23
24
this->selectionChanged +=
Delegate
(listener, &
ISelectionChangedListener::SelectionChanged
);
25
}
26
27
void
28
ISelectionChangedListener::Events
29
::RemoveListener
(
ISelectionChangedListener
* listener)
30
{
31
if
(listener ==
nullptr
)
return
;
32
33
this->selectionChanged -=
Delegate
(listener, &
ISelectionChangedListener::SelectionChanged
);
34
}
35
36
ISelectionChangedListener::~ISelectionChangedListener
()
37
{
38
}
39
40
}
berry
Definition:
QmitkPropertyItemModel.h:23
berryISelectionChangedListener.h
berryISelectionProvider.h
berry::ISelectionChangedListener::~ISelectionChangedListener
virtual ~ISelectionChangedListener()
Definition:
berryISelectionChangedListener.cpp:36
berry::ISelectionChangedListener::Events::RemoveListener
void RemoveListener(ISelectionChangedListener *listener)
Definition:
berryISelectionChangedListener.cpp:29
berry::ISelectionChangedListener::SelectionChanged
virtual void SelectionChanged(const SelectionChangedEvent::Pointer &event)=0
berry::ISelectionChangedListener
Definition:
berryISelectionChangedListener.h:37
berry::ISelectionChangedListener::Events::AddListener
void AddListener(ISelectionChangedListener *listener)
Definition:
berryISelectionChangedListener.cpp:20
berry::MessageDelegate1
Definition:
berryMessage.h:170
Source
Plugins
org.blueberry.ui.qt
src
berryISelectionChangedListener.cpp
Generated on Thu Mar 12 2020 10:23:32 for Medical Imaging Interaction Toolkit by
1.8.13